A student uses the Distributive Property to rewrite 18 + 54 . Which expression could the student use?

Mathematics
1 answer:
Setler79 [48]3 years ago
6 0
A(b+c)=a•b+a•c
18=18•1
54=18•3
18(1+3)=18•1+18•3

Solve the following: S5 for 600 + 300 + 150 + .
Tresset [83]
600 + 300 + 150 + . . . is a geometric sequence with a = 600 and r = 1/2
Sn = a(1 - r^n)/(1 - r)
S5 = 600(1 - (1/2)^5)/(1 - 1/2) = 600(1 - 1/32)/(1/2) = 1,200(31/32) = 1,162.5
